The Rationale Behind Peptide Stacking

The core principle of peptide stacking lies in synergy. By combining peptides with distinct but complementary mechanisms of action, users aim to create more powerful outcomes than a single peptide could achieve alone. For instance, a growth hormone-releasing peptide might be stacked with another peptide that enhances cellular repair, leading to more significant gains in muscle mass and recovery. Determining the "Right" Number of Peptides

There isn't a universal answer to "how many peptides can you stack," as it's not simply about quantity but about intelligent combination. Some sources suggest that combining two or three peptides is a common and effective starting point for many goals. Safety and Potential Risks

As with any therapeutic intervention, peptide stacking carries potential risks. Safety depends on the quality of the peptides, their sourcing, appropriate dosages, and the method of administration.
